Chennai: In Chennai, strong winds and rainfall occurred ahead of Pakistan's sixth World Cup match against South Africa.
The India Meteorological Department predicted rain in Chennai, and while there was rain this morning with strong winds, it has since stopped.
Clouds linger, and if more rain comes, the match might start slightly late.
However, the forecast doesn't predict heavy rainfall today.
Pakistan is set to face South Africa at Chidambaram Stadium, with South Africa ranking second on the points table and Pakistan in sixth place after three consecutive losses.
